IUPAC Name: Methyl 8-methoxynaphtho[2,1-g][1,3]benzodioxole-5-carboxylate
Synonyms of Methyl aristolate (CAS NO.35142-06-4): 8-Methoxyphenanthro(3,4-d)-1,3-dioxole-5-carboxylic acid methyl ester ; Aristolic acid methyl ester ; Phenanthro(3,4-d)-1,3-dioxole-5-carboxylic acid, 8-methoxy-, methyl ester
CAS NO: 35142-06-4
Molecular Formula: C18H14O5
Molecular Weight : 310.3008
Molecular Structure:
H bond acceptors: 5
H bond donors: 0
Freely Rotating Bonds: 3
Polar Surface Area: 53.99Å2
Index of Refraction: 1.673
Molar Refractivity: 86.55 cm3
Molar Volume: 230.7 cm3
Surface Tension: 56.2 dyne/cm
Density: 1.344 g/cm3
Flash Point: 225.7 °C
Enthalpy of Vaporization: 77.44 kJ/mol
Boiling Point: 504.9 °C at 760 mmHg
Vapour Pressure: 2.55E-10 mmHg at 25°C
Experimental reproductive effects. When Methyl aristolate (CAS NO.35142-06-4) is heated to decomposition, it emits acrid smoke and irritating fumes.
